计算机系统的核心构成要素包括中央处理单元(CPU)、存储器、输入输出设备以及总线系统等。这些部件共同协作,确保计算机能够高效、稳定地运行。下面将详细探讨这些核心构成要素:
1. 中央处理单元(CPU):
- CPU是计算机的大脑,负责执行指令和处理数据。它由多个不同的电路组成,包括算术逻辑单元(ALU)、控制单元(CU)、寄存器(R)和浮点运算单元(FPU)等。
- CPU的分类主要基于其架构,如精简指令集计算机(RISC)和复杂指令集计算机(CISC)。RISC架构的CPU具有更简单的指令集,适合高速计算,而CISC架构的CPU则因其丰富的指令集而广泛应用于商业市场。
- 现代CPU在提升性能的同时,也在功耗和成本方面进行了优化,以满足日益增长的市场需求。
2. 存储器:
- 存储器用于暂存运行中的程序和数据,分为内存储器(RAM)和外存储器(ROM)两种类型。RAM提供快速的数据处理能力,适用于暂时存储正在运行的程序或数据;而ROM则用于存储永久的程序代码,如操作系统或固件。
- RAM根据访问速度和速度可分为随机存取存储器(RAM)和静态RAM(SRAM)。RAM速度快但价格高,而SRAM速度快且价格便宜,但速度随时间推移会下降。
3. 输入输出设备:
- 输入设备包括键盘、鼠标、图形扫描仪等,用于接收用户的操作和命令。这些设备将用户的输入转换为计算机可以识别的信号。
- 输出设备包括显示器、打印机、扬声器等,用于显示计算机的处理结果和向用户输出信息。这些设备将计算机的处理结果转化为用户可以理解的形式。
- 输入输出设备的选择和布局直接影响到用户与计算机系统的交互体验。例如,触摸屏技术的出现使得输入设备更加直观和舒适。
4. 总线系统:
- 总线是连接计算机各部件的通信通道,确保数据和指令能准确无误地在各个部件间传递。总线的速度和可靠性对整个计算机系统的性能有重大影响。
- 常见的总线系统包括局部总线、内存总线、扩展总线等。局部总线用于连接CPU与内存,内存总线连接CPU与主内存,扩展总线则用于连接多个外部设备或子系统。
5. 存储系统:
- 存储系统负责长期保存数据,包括硬盘驱动器、固态驱动器(SSD)和光盘驱动器等。存储系统的选择直接影响到数据的安全性和访问速度。
- 存储系统的设计包括文件系统的组织和管理机制,如文件分配表(FAT)和NTFS等。这些文件系统帮助计算机有效地管理和访问存储在硬盘上的数据。
6. 电源管理:
- 电源管理涉及确保计算机各组件获得稳定的电力供应,同时减少能源浪费。这包括电源设计、电源保护机制和电源效率优化等方面。
- 随着环保意识的提升,低功耗技术和节能模式成为现代计算机系统设计的重要考量因素。这不仅有助于延长设备的使用时间,也符合可持续发展的理念。
7. 散热系统:
- 散热系统确保计算机各组件在适宜的温度下运行,防止过热导致的性能下降甚至损坏。有效的散热不仅关系到硬件的寿命,还影响到系统的稳定运行。
- 散热技术包括风扇、散热器和液体冷却等。其中,液体冷却技术以其较低的温度和较高的热传导效率,越来越受到重视。
综上所述,计算机系统的核心构成要素包括CPU、存储器、输入输出设备、总线系统和电源管理等。这些要素相互协作,确保计算机能够高效、稳定地运行。通过深入理解这些核心构成要素,可以更好地设计和优化计算机系统,满足不同领域的需求。同时,持续关注新技术和新发展也将为计算机科学的发展带来新的机遇和挑战。